Qid a écritle demandeur n'a plus le lien entre firefox et son bureau pour le site extensions gnome et je me demande dans quelles mesures ce ne serait pas parce-que il utiliserait firefox en Snap...
Rien à voir avec snap dans ce cas. Il manquait juste
sudo apt install chrome-gnome-shell
Ce truc ne devrait-il pas s'installer automatiquement avec l'environnement gnome-shell ?
En cas de navigateur web en snap
⋅ s'assurer que
chrome-gnome-shell est installé côté système
⋅ puis avec le navigateur web en snap en question, se rendre sur la page
https://extensions.gnome.org/ qui proposera l'installation du module nécessaire, l'accepter ( ça l'installera donc dans le profil du navigateur web en snap ).
Si ça coince vérifier qu'il n'y a pas de problèmes de droits et permissions dans le répertoire personnel de l'$USER ( notamment sur .dbus ).
Comme toujours avec un logiciel en snap :
⋅ par défaut la grosse plupart du temps, il n'accède qu'à
/home/$USER
⋅ si l'utilisateur doit accéder à d'autres partitions avec une appli
snap, la connecter à l'interface
removable-media
→ en graphique : soit via
logiciel, la page du
snap en question, bouton [ autorisations ] à côté de [ lancer | supprimer ]

→ soit ( à partir de 20.04 ) via
paramètres système / applications
← ceci est un .gif animé
→ en commande :
snap connect application:removable-media
⋅ dès lors le snap à accès à
/home + /media + /mnt + /run/media
⋅ ce qui implique : connecter l'interface removable-media est un préalable impératif incontournable sur une appli' snap
→ si des datas perso de l'utilisateur se trouvent « physiquement » ailleurs que dans le dossier /home ( autre disque, autre partition, ressource en réseau )
→ les points de montage de ces diverses ressources doivent impérativement se trouver dans /home ou /media ou /mnt ou /run/media et nulle part ailleurs ( par ex. pas direct à la racine du système genre /data )